## Update the OpenRAG documentation PDF
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
The documentation PDF at `openrag/documents/openrag-documentation.pdf` is used by the OpenRAG application, so keep it up to date.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
To update the PDF, do the following: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
1. Remove elements from the `docs/*.mdx` files.
|
||||||
|
Content in tabs, details, and summary elements is hidden from PDF builds and it must be included.
|
||||||
|
To remove these items, give the following prompt or something similar to your IDE.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
Flatten documentation for PDF: remove tabs and details elements
|
||||||
|
In all MDX files in docs/docs/, flatten interactive elements:
|
||||||
|
Remove all <Tabs> and <TabItem> components:
|
||||||
|
Convert each tab's content to a regular section with an appropriate heading (### for subsections, ## for main sections)
|
||||||
|
Show all tab content sequentially
|
||||||
|
Remove the import statements for Tabs and TabItem where they're no longer used
|
||||||
|
Remove all <details> and <summary> elements:
|
||||||
|
Convert details content to regular text with an appropriate heading (### for subsections)
|
||||||
|
Show all content directly (no collapsible sections)
|
||||||
|
Keep all content visible — nothing should be hidden or collapsed
|
||||||
|
Maintain proper formatting and structure
|
||||||
|
Apply this to all documentation files that contain tabs or details elements so the content is fully flat and visible for PDF generation.
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
2. Check your `.mdx` files to confirm these elements are removed.
|
||||||
|
Don't commit the changes.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
3. From `openrag/docs`, run this command to build the site with the changes, and create a PDF at `openrag/documents`.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
npm run build:pdf
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
4. Check the PDF's content, then commit and create a pull request.

## Reinstall OpenRAG {#reinstall}
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
To reinstall OpenRAG with a completely fresh setup: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
1. Reset your containers using the **Reset** button in the [TUI status](#status) menu.
|
||||||
|
This removes all containers, volumes, and data.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
2. Optional: Delete your project's `.env` file.
|
||||||
|
The Reset operation does not remove your project's `.env` file, so your passwords, API keys, and OAuth settings can be preserved.
|
||||||
|
If you delete the `.env` file, run the [Set up OpenRAG with the TUI](#setup) process again to create a new configuration.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
3. In the TUI Setup menu, follow these steps from [Basic Setup](#setup):
|
||||||
|
1. Click **Start All Services** to pull container images and start them.
|
||||||
|
2. Under **Native Services**, click **Start** to start the Docling service.
|
||||||
|
3. Click **Open App** to open the OpenRAG application.
|
||||||
|
4. Continue with [Application Onboarding](#application-onboarding).
